BDA Scotland and its elected committee members seek to improve conditions for the delivery of dental services across the country, negotiating directly with the Scottish Government.
Dentists working in Scotland are represented through the
Scottish Council, the
Scottish Dental Practice Committee, the
Scottish Public Dental Service Committee and the
Scottish Hospital Dentists Reference Group.
Scotland is also represented through one seat on the BDA’s Principal Executive Committee, our executive board, which sets our policy and strategic direction.
We also seek to influence other key-decision makers, including educational institutions, political parties and statutory, and non-statutory organisations.
Our committees meet regularly to consider the issues affecting the dental profession and patient care. BDA representatives take these issues forward into discussion and negotiation with the Scottish Government and the range of bodies responsible for delivery of health and social care.
